Dating back to 1830, the Old Port of Montreal offers a unique historical adventure through it's cobblestone streets. You'll also find some great restaurants for an authentic french gastronomy experience. Distance: 8 miles / 13 km Time: 10-15 minutes by car

This colossal and architecturally unique stadium was built to host the 1976 summer Olympics. Explore all of its venues from and ride the elevator 900 feet to the top of the world tallest inclined tower. At the top, the Observatory offer spectacular view of the beautiful city of Montreal and if you're luck enough to witness the sunset, do yourself a favor and make sure your phone has enough battery to capture this memorable moment! Distance: 16.5 miles / 27 km Time: 30 minutes by car (mostly because of traffic lights)

Hike or drive up Mount Royal, the small mountain located right to the west of the downtown area. Along the way, you will encounter lookout spots that offer breathtaking unobstructed views of the city. Distance: 9 miles / 15 km Time: 20 minutes by car

For all your shopping needs look no further than the new Quartier DIX30 area located right in Brossard. It is considered Canada's first lifestyle center and occupies an area of 2,746,063 sq ft (255,117.6 m^2). It was designed to emulate an urban or downtown shopping experience with boutiques and entertainment. Distance: 3 miles / 5 km Time: 10 minutes by car
